Inter Miami are close to appointing former Argentina international Cristian “Kily” González as head coach, replacing interim manager Guillermo Hoyos amid a five-match winless run. The change is significant for a side expected to defend its MLS Cup title but now struggling for form despite Lionel Messi’s return and several high-profile signings.

Hoyos took charge after Javier Mascherano resigned in April and has been suspended for one match over repeated late kick-offs. González, from Messi’s home city of Rosario, has a 32.5% career win rate as a manager and most recently coached Platense; Inter Miami sit 10 points behind Eastern Conference leaders Nashville, third in the Supporters’ Shield table.
